Guide to the Nachlaot Neighborhood in Jerusalem
What is Nachlaot?
Nachlaot is a group of historic Jerusalem neighborhoods (19 neighborhoods in total) built at the end of the 19th century and the beginning of the 20th. A maze of alleys, attached houses, shared courtyards — one of the unique urban fabrics in Israel.
Location
5 minutes from Mahane Yehuda, 10 minutes from the Knesset, 2 minutes from the light rail (Shuk station). A very central location.
Atmosphere
"Jerusalem Bohemia" — artists, musicians, writers, interesting characters. In the shared courtyards, friendships still form like in old neighborhoods. A feeling that cannot be bought in a store.
Mahane Yehuda Market
The beating heart of Nachlaot. 5 minutes walk. Shopping, food, culture, entertainment — it’s all there.
Disadvantages
- Parking — almost impossible
- Old buildings — maintenance costs
- Relatively small properties
- Noise from the nearby Mahane Yehuda
